You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@uima.apache.org by Marshall Schor <ms...@schor.com> on 2008/03/01 01:55:42 UTC

Re: svn commit: r630201 - /incubator/uima/uimaj/trunk/uimaj-distr/src/main/assembly/src.xml

I think this may not be quite right.

When you do an extract, the uima-docbook-tool/lib and some other 
directories will be empty, but in the process of building the docbook, 
it will "fill up" with jars we don't distribute, but which the build 
script downloads from the internet if the user is "OK" with the 
licenses.  If then the "build source" assembly runs, it seems it will 
include this stuff in the source distr.

-Marshall

mbaessler@apache.org wrote:
> Author: mbaessler
> Date: Fri Feb 22 05:37:23 2008
> New Revision: 630201
>
> URL: http://svn.apache.org/viewvc?rev=630201&view=rev
> Log:
> UIMA-764
>
> update src distribution build to be able to create a binary distribution from it
>
> https://issues.apache.org/jira/browse/UIMA-764
>
> Modified:
>     incubator/uima/uimaj/trunk/uimaj-distr/src/main/assembly/src.xml
>
> Modified: incubator/uima/uimaj/trunk/uimaj-distr/src/main/assembly/src.xml
> URL: http://svn.apache.org/viewvc/incubator/uima/uimaj/trunk/uimaj-distr/src/main/assembly/src.xml?rev=630201&r1=630200&r2=630201&view=diff
> ==============================================================================
> --- incubator/uima/uimaj/trunk/uimaj-distr/src/main/assembly/src.xml (original)
> +++ incubator/uima/uimaj/trunk/uimaj-distr/src/main/assembly/src.xml Fri Feb 22 05:37:23 2008
> @@ -52,14 +52,59 @@
>        <outputDirectory>/uima-docbooks</outputDirectory>
>        <excludes>
>          <exclude>target/**</exclude>
> -        <exclude>docbook/**</exclude>
> -        <exclude>lib/**</exclude>
> -        <exclude>Source_UIMA_SDK_Guide_Ref/**</exclude>
> +        <!-- Directories does not exist -->
> +        <!-- <exclude>docbook/**</exclude>  -->
> +        <!-- <exclude>lib/**</exclude> -->
> +        <!-- <exclude>Source_UIMA_SDK_Guide_Ref/**</exclude> -->
>          <exclude>.*</exclude>   
>          <exclude>LICENSE.txt</exclude>
>          <exclude>src/styles/titlepage/*.xsl</exclude>     
>        </excludes>
>      </fileSet>   
> +    <fileSet>
> +      <directory>../uima-docbook-tool</directory>
> +      <outputDirectory>/uima-docbook-tool</outputDirectory>
> +      <includes>
> +        <include>build/**</include>
> +        <include>catalog/**</include>
> +        <include>properties/**</include>
> +        <include>styles/**</include>
> +        <include>tools/**</include>
> +        <include>xinclude.mod</include> 
> +        <include>README</include>
> +        <include>README.FIRST</include>
> +      </includes>
> +    </fileSet>
> +    <fileSet>
> +      <directory>../uimaj-eclipse-update-site</directory>
> +      <outputDirectory>/uimaj-eclipse-update-site</outputDirectory>
> +      <includes>
> +        <include>features/**</include>
> +        <include>plugins/**</include>
> +        <include>web/**</include>
> +        <include>build.xml</include>
> +        <include>index.html</include>
> +        <include>site.xml</include>
> +      </includes>
> +    </fileSet>    
> +    <fileSet>
> +      <directory>../uimaj-eclipse-feature-runtime</directory>
> +      <outputDirectory>/uimaj-eclipse-feature-runtime</outputDirectory>
> +      <includes>
> +        <include>build.properties</include>
> +        <include>feature.properties</include>
> +        <include>feature.xml</include>
> +      </includes>
> +    </fileSet>    
> +    <fileSet>
> +      <directory>../uimaj-eclipse-feature-tools</directory>
> +      <outputDirectory>/uimaj-eclipse-feature-tools</outputDirectory>
> +      <includes>
> +        <include>build.properties</include>
> +        <include>feature.properties</include>
> +        <include>feature.xml</include>
> +      </includes>
> +    </fileSet>    
>      <fileSet>
>        <directory>../uimaj</directory>
>        <outputDirectory>/uimaj</outputDirectory>
>
>
>
>
>   


Re: svn commit: r630201 - /incubator/uima/uimaj/trunk/uimaj-distr/src/main/assembly/src.xml

Posted by Thilo Goetz <tw...@gmx.de>.
I'll take a crack at this.

--Thilo

Marshall Schor wrote:
> I think this may not be quite right.
> 
> When you do an extract, the uima-docbook-tool/lib and some other 
> directories will be empty, but in the process of building the docbook, 
> it will "fill up" with jars we don't distribute, but which the build 
> script downloads from the internet if the user is "OK" with the 
> licenses.  If then the "build source" assembly runs, it seems it will 
> include this stuff in the source distr.
> 
> -Marshall
> 
> mbaessler@apache.org wrote:
>> Author: mbaessler
>> Date: Fri Feb 22 05:37:23 2008
>> New Revision: 630201
>>
>> URL: http://svn.apache.org/viewvc?rev=630201&view=rev
>> Log:
>> UIMA-764
>>
>> update src distribution build to be able to create a binary 
>> distribution from it
>>
>> https://issues.apache.org/jira/browse/UIMA-764
>>
>> Modified:
>>     incubator/uima/uimaj/trunk/uimaj-distr/src/main/assembly/src.xml
>>
>> Modified: 
>> incubator/uima/uimaj/trunk/uimaj-distr/src/main/assembly/src.xml
>> URL: 
>> http://svn.apache.org/viewvc/incubator/uima/uimaj/trunk/uimaj-distr/src/main/assembly/src.xml?rev=630201&r1=630200&r2=630201&view=diff 
>>
>> ============================================================================== 
>>
>> --- incubator/uima/uimaj/trunk/uimaj-distr/src/main/assembly/src.xml 
>> (original)
>> +++ incubator/uima/uimaj/trunk/uimaj-distr/src/main/assembly/src.xml 
>> Fri Feb 22 05:37:23 2008
>> @@ -52,14 +52,59 @@
>>        <outputDirectory>/uima-docbooks</outputDirectory>
>>        <excludes>
>>          <exclude>target/**</exclude>
>> -        <exclude>docbook/**</exclude>
>> -        <exclude>lib/**</exclude>
>> -        <exclude>Source_UIMA_SDK_Guide_Ref/**</exclude>
>> +        <!-- Directories does not exist -->
>> +        <!-- <exclude>docbook/**</exclude>  -->
>> +        <!-- <exclude>lib/**</exclude> -->
>> +        <!-- <exclude>Source_UIMA_SDK_Guide_Ref/**</exclude> -->
>>          <exclude>.*</exclude>            <exclude>LICENSE.txt</exclude>
>>          <exclude>src/styles/titlepage/*.xsl</exclude>            
>> </excludes>
>>      </fileSet>   +    <fileSet>
>> +      <directory>../uima-docbook-tool</directory>
>> +      <outputDirectory>/uima-docbook-tool</outputDirectory>
>> +      <includes>
>> +        <include>build/**</include>
>> +        <include>catalog/**</include>
>> +        <include>properties/**</include>
>> +        <include>styles/**</include>
>> +        <include>tools/**</include>
>> +        <include>xinclude.mod</include> +        
>> <include>README</include>
>> +        <include>README.FIRST</include>
>> +      </includes>
>> +    </fileSet>
>> +    <fileSet>
>> +      <directory>../uimaj-eclipse-update-site</directory>
>> +      <outputDirectory>/uimaj-eclipse-update-site</outputDirectory>
>> +      <includes>
>> +        <include>features/**</include>
>> +        <include>plugins/**</include>
>> +        <include>web/**</include>
>> +        <include>build.xml</include>
>> +        <include>index.html</include>
>> +        <include>site.xml</include>
>> +      </includes>
>> +    </fileSet>    +    <fileSet>
>> +      <directory>../uimaj-eclipse-feature-runtime</directory>
>> +      <outputDirectory>/uimaj-eclipse-feature-runtime</outputDirectory>
>> +      <includes>
>> +        <include>build.properties</include>
>> +        <include>feature.properties</include>
>> +        <include>feature.xml</include>
>> +      </includes>
>> +    </fileSet>    +    <fileSet>
>> +      <directory>../uimaj-eclipse-feature-tools</directory>
>> +      <outputDirectory>/uimaj-eclipse-feature-tools</outputDirectory>
>> +      <includes>
>> +        <include>build.properties</include>
>> +        <include>feature.properties</include>
>> +        <include>feature.xml</include>
>> +      </includes>
>> +    </fileSet>         <fileSet>
>>        <directory>../uimaj</directory>
>>        <outputDirectory>/uimaj</outputDirectory>
>>
>>
>>
>>
>>